CITY OF CHANHASSEN
CARVER AND HENNEPIN COUNTIES, MINNESOTA
CONDITIONAL USE PERMIT #05-30
1. Permit. Subject to the terms and conditions set forth herein, the City of Chanhassen
hereby grants a conditional use permit for the following use:
An Electric Substation and a 10-foot wall in an Industrial Office Park District.
2. Property. The permit is for property situated in the City of Chanhassen, Carver County,
Minnesota, and legally described as follows:
See Attached Exhibit A.
3. Conditions. The permit is issued for the construction of an Electric Substation and a
lO-foot wall as shown on the plans dated received September 2 and November 30,2005 with
the following condition:
a. A security fence as specified in the National Electric Safety Code shall
surround the Distribution and Underground Electric Distribution Substations.
4. Termination of Permit. The City may revoke the permit following a public hearing for
violation of the terms of this permit.
5. Lapse. If within one year of the issuance of this permit the authorized construction has
not been substantially completed or the use commenced, this permit shall lapse, unless an extension
is granted in accordance with the Chanhassen Zoning Ordinance.
6. Criminal Penalty. Violation of the terms of this conditional use permit is a criminal
misdemeanor.
